EPG systems  Wageningen  Netherlands          Stylet       Stylet  d v1 25  11 09 2014   Stylet a v01 25  19 09 2014     User Manual             versions        Free Software for EPG acquisition  and EPG analysis in Windows   XP   7 or  8    Software package parts    Shortcut icon to run EPG data acquisition  daq  for the Giga 8d  FPE It also includes a routine for separate conversion  see Separate conversion     Ere Shortcut to run EPG signal analysis  ana  for Stylet d acquired data files       Contents    1  Introduction l  2  Installing and System requirements l  3  Data Acquisition 2  4  EPG Analysis 4  5  Trouble shooting 10      Latest versions always available on the downloads page of the website     For Mac  see footnote page 2    Manual Stylet  v01 25x doc January 2015 www epgsystems eu    1  Introduction    Stylet  is Windows  based software package for EPG data acquisition and analysis of EPG signals  The  program is written in Delphy and replaces the earlier STYLET and PROBE software operating with  DOS and Windows 98  XP  respectively  Stylet  can be used without any licence and is free  downloadable from www epgsystems eu  We are developing new versions regularly  the latest ones will  always be put on the website  We welcome any suggestions for improvements or additional features     The Stylet d data acquisition has been developed for Giga 8d hardware with build in AD device for  analog digital conversion and USB output signal for computer display and data fi

19. onds in a recording time of several hours     Overruns   During acquisition on the bottom bar the number overruns is displayed  This number should be  as low as possible  The number increases if other programs are on or used during recording or  the computer is connected to intranet or internet  Disable these connections during data  acquisition and don   t use other programs on the computer during EPG recording     Error 103   At  Start  of the analysis routine  Stylet a this error message will be shown when the data file    DO1  is a    read only    file  The read only property may sometimes be initiated during file  transfer or copying  If put on CDRom files will always be changed to read only files  In  explorer a R mouse click and subsequent selection of Properties allows you to remove the read  only check property and make the file accessible but on a CDRom this cannot be changed and  files should be copied first to your hard disk for use in Stylet a     1
